Michelle Buteau Says She Won’t Return as Circle Host

Michelle Buteau, who hosted The Circle’s U.S. run on Netflix for all seven seasons from 2020 through 2024, reacted to the show’s move to Hulu—confirming she won’t be returning as host as the series gets reimagined with civilians and celebrities.
Michelle Buteau didn’t dodge the question on Sunday.
During her appearance on the June 21 episode of Bravo’s Watch What Happens Live, the 48-year-old comedian was asked about major news for The Circle. She hosted all seven seasons of the Netflix reality competition series from 2020 through 2024, and the show has been on break since then.
Now Hulu has picked up the show for a new version. The plan is to bring everyday competitors and celebrity contestants together in the same game. with a new audience voting component included for the first time in the U.S. The format will be “reimagined” as a “fast-turnaround” social experiment set in real time.
Buteau said she was happy the series found a new home. calling it “a great show.” She then made it clear she wasn’t coming back. “I hosted the U.S. version. the longest-running version for seven seasons. and I put my foot in it. my back. my back fat. my right titty. I put all the stuff in it. But. they’re not going to go through with me being the host and so I say. good luck. bless up. I hope you have fun putting a square in the circle. ” she said on Watch What Happens Live.
The new Hulu version will keep the basic premise that separates players while forcing them to adapt. Contestants will move into separate apartments in the same building and be kept isolated from one another. They’ll be limited to communicating through a specific app using text and photos. with players able to choose to compete as themselves or as someone else.
The shift from Netflix to Hulu is also paired with a new way for viewers to weigh in, including audience voting for the first time in the U.S., while the “fast-turnaround” and real-time setup promises a different pace for the game.
